Jimmy Stewart plays an enterprising attorney, who rises to political fame and power because — as legend has it — he is the man that shot Liberty Valance!

Liberty Valance was a notorious road agent and outlaw, who terrorized the town folk and farmers in the area.

Now, at the end of the movie, it’s revealed that Jimmy Stewart’s character didn’t actually shoot Liberty Valance (he missed).  Instead, it was Stewart’s one-time friend, the legendary cowboy Doniphon (played by John Wayne), that actually took out Valance with a rifle, from a dark alley.  

Spoiler alert!  Ooops, too late! :^)

Now, as the Jimmy Stewart character looks back on his life, he tells the news reporter that he didn’t actually shoot Liberty Valance.

In a twist, the reporter throws his notes into the fire, and says “This is the West.  When the legend becomes fact, print the legend.”
